Output 65569617fcf3124e3208dcf77cd125ea01283dece13448e3b283021f9b558fb7:0

value
334687
script pubkey
OP_0 OP_PUSHBYTES_20 62fe68405903ff4d31f3c18742ba4c36774e142c
address
bc1qvtlxsszeq0l56v0ncxr59wjvxem5u9pvzedsk6
transaction
65569617fcf3124e3208dcf77cd125ea01283dece13448e3b283021f9b558fb7
confirmations
139039
spent
true